When a person types in a keyword or keyword phrase to search
for anything, the search engines gives out the results in a page.
 
Then at the right side of the page, you will see selected ads
that have paid for their ads to be viewed with certain keywords
and keyword phrases searched.

For example, Lets say you run a car parts retail/wholesale site.
You choose keywords that can prompt or trigger your ads to be
shown in the page when a keyword is searched. When a search
engine user types in Honda Accord, your ad may come up if you
have designated that as one of your keywords.

You will have to pony up some cash when using this service
though. There are different ways Yahoo/Overture will charge you.
 
It may be in the number of Keywords or Keyword phrases your
ad uses or in the many times your ad is clicked on. Others offer
many other services like having your ad show up not only
in the search engine pages but also with some third party sites.

Third party sites support ads that have the same theme or niche
as them. With more areas your ad is shown, you increase the
chances of people knowing about your site or product.
